您好,欢迎来到二三娱乐。
搜索
您的当前位置:首页学习笔记《前后端分离架构》

学习笔记《前后端分离架构》

来源:二三娱乐

前后端分离的好处:

  • 后端的复用
  • 前后端更加自由的独立作业
  • 分工造成专业
  • 按照标准交付(后端可以做兼职了)

新事物的产生:

  • 前端高速发展
  • JS框架
  • CSS脚本化
  • 前端编译技术
  • Single-page Application
  • 接口相关技术
  • 类似 Swagger 一样的接口标准
  • REST 具有更高的可行性
  • 数据传输标准 JSend, JSON API
  • HTTP2 对请求的合并
  • 后端细化
  • 为接口而生的 PHP 框架
  • 路由层的显现

是否REST

模板,谁来处理?

因为第一个页面的请求,目前依然是由 PHP 渲染的,所以 PHP 会处理相关的模板,也就是 include 相关的,而其后的请求因为都是 AJAX 的数据拉取,由 JS 来渲染,所以是由前端的模板引擎来处理,所以在这个情况下,是前后端模板并用的阶段

引入 node 然后做前后端的彻底分离

引入新的技术手段,让前后端彻底分离,这个对团队的前端能力会更上一个台阶,但是必要性没有那么强

是否 Single-page Application

没有概念

SEO相关

没有特别好的解决方案,针对那些最需要SEO的页面和内容,不采用AJAX数据请求的形式

Copyright © 2019- yule263.com 版权所有 湘ICP备2023023988号-1

违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务